> Crashes due to android 7.0 "file://" Handling 
> "android.os.FileUriExposedException"

> Android 7.0 removes the "file://" Protocol or to be more precise, removes the 
> possibility to share URIs with "file://" Protocol outside the Scope of the 
> own App. If some Code tries this, the result is 
> "android.os.FileUriExposedException".
> This affects a variety of Plugins:
> - inAppBrowser: opening a file:// URI (e.g. to show a downloaded PDF) crasehs 
> the app, 
> - Camera crashes immediately: opening a cached File by 
> "ClipData.Item.getUri()"
> - possible a couple of the File Plugin Methods
